The tropical climate of Bali means it's warm all year round, but the dry season from April to October is ideal for beach outings, exploring temples, and outdoor adventures. To enjoy a more relaxed experience, consider planning your trip during shoulder months when peak tourist seasons and major festivals have subsided. This way, you get the best of Bali’s offerings without the crowds.

When exploring a Bali Indonesia trip, you simply cannot miss the island’s iconic landmarks. Temples such as Tanah Lot and Uluwatu offer dramatic seascapes and spiritual experiences, while the lush Tegallalang Rice Terraces provide a glimpse of Bali’s breathtaking natural artistry. Don't forget to explore cultural sites like Besakih Temple and the Gates of Heaven at Lempuyang Temple that truly showcase the island’s heritage.

Finding the perfect location to stay while planning your Bali Indonesia trip is essential for maximizing your experience. Ubud is ideal for those seeking culture and nature, while Seminyak caters to travelers looking for luxury and nightlife. For a laid-back vibe and easy access to surfing spots, Canggu is the destination of choice. Meanwhile, Nusa Dua is perfect for families who desire a safe and serene environment with plenty of kid-friendly options.

Adventure seekers will find plenty to do during a Bali Indonesia trip. Activities like hiking Mount Batur offer exhilarating experiences and vistas that will leave you in awe. For those looking for a thrill, white-water rafting in the island’s rivers and diving in the clear waters of Tulamben are must-try adventures. Alternatively, unwind with a rejuvenating Balinese massage or partake in a soothing yoga retreat that invites relaxation and inner peace.
If you’re looking to explore beyond the typical tourist trail, Bali offers many hidden gems. Consider visiting the serene Sidemen Valley or exploring the traditional Penglipuran Village, where time seems to stand still. Discovering lesser-known waterfalls, such as Tukad Cepung, will reward you with breathtaking natural displays away from the usual hustle and bustle.
